  3. Governor of Kentucky. The Governor of the Commonwealth of Kentucky is an elected constitutional officer, the head of the executive branch and the highest state office in Kentucky. The governor is popularly elected every four years by a plurality and is limited to two consecutive terms.

  4. Gubernatorial History. Fifty-nine individuals have held the office of Governor of Kentucky. Prior to a 1992 amendment to the state's constitution, a Governor was prohibited from succeeding himself in office, though four men – Isaac Shelby, John LaRue Helm, James B. McCreary and A.B. "Happy" Chandler – served multiple non-consecutive terms.
